LMS – Game 2 – Round 3 Results

2nd-4th November

41 players were still standing for Round 3. Nine different teams were picked in this round – the only game not picked was the United v Chelsea game (which was proven to be a wise decision!).

On Saturday, in the lunchtime game, Newcastle entertained Arsenal at St James’ Park – Janet Carr had picked the Gunners. No entry was received from Ste Matthews, so he got Arsenal by default – a 1-0 defeat sees Janet and Ste drop out. In the 3pm kick-offs, Bournemouth hosted Manchester City at the Vitality Stadium – Allan Jones, Dave Phillips, Dave Rogers, Jason Harrison, and John Lamming had picked City but they bow out after a 2-1 defeat. Ipswich were still looking for their first win of the season as they played Leicester at Portman Road – John Roberts had picked Ipswich and they nearly got that 1st win but a late equaiser sees him drop out after a 1-1 draw. Liverpool faced Brighton at Anfield – 20 players were hoping that the Reds could get a second win in a week over the Seagulls and they were rewarded with a 2-1 win. Nottingham Forest took on West Ham at the City Ground – 6 players had picked Nottingham Forest and they ease through with a 3-0 win. Southampton played Everton at St Mary’s – Michael Grierson had picked the Toffees but he exits after a 1-0 defeat. In the teatime game, Wolves welcomed Crystal Palace to Molineux – Alex Ramsden and Craig Milton had picked Wolves but a 2-2 draw sees them also drop out.
On Sunday, Tottenham faced Aston Villa at the Tottenham Stadium – Andrew Wilkinson had picked Spurs and he goes through after a 4-1 win.
On Monday night, Fulham welcomed Brentford to Craven Cottage – Ben Donafee, Gisela Mowles, and Paul Murphy had picked Fulham and they scrape through after two injury time goals as the Cottagers won 2-1.

In total, 11 players dropped out in this round, leaving 30 players still standing. Deadline for Round 4 is Friday 8th November at noon. A full update can be viewed here.

LMS – Game 2 – Round 1 Results

ROUND 1
19th-21st October

Web SiteLMS RulesHall of Fame

Game 2 kicked off with 110 players – meaning a prize pot of £550. Ten different teams were picked in this opening round – two of them in the same game. Southampton v Leicester was the only game not to feature.

On Saturday, in the lunchtime game, Tottenham faced West Ham in a London derby at the Tottenham stadium – 28 players had picked Spurs and they eased through with a 4-1 win. In the 3pm games, Fulham took on Aston Villa at Craven Cottage – Gary Donely and Paul Barlow backed the Cottagers but go out after a 3-1 defeat. Ipswich were still looking for their 1st win of the season as they welcomed Everton to Portman Road – Jack Horsler had picked Ipswich Town while Gemma Jackson had picked the Toffees, and it’s Gemma who goes through after a 2-0 win for the Blues. Newcastle faced Brighton at St James’ Park – 7 players were hoping the Magpies could overcome the Seagulls but a 1-0 defeat sees them drop out. In the teatime game, Bournemouth welcomed Arsenal to the Vitality stadium – 31 players had picked the Gunners but a surprise 2-0 defeat sees an early exit for them all.
On Sunday, in the early game, Wolves faced Manchester City at Molineux – 31 players were hoping for a City win and it looked like a second LMS upet was on the cards until a last minute winner saw City win 2-1. In the later game, Liverpool took on Chelsea at Anfield – Dave Rogers and Paul Murphy had picked the Reds and they go through after a 2-1 win.
Finally, on Monday night, Nottingham Forest played Crystal Palace at the City Ground – Alex Ramsden, Joel Wilkinson, Marie Robinson, Michael Grierson and Tony Smith had picked Forest and a 1-0 was enough to put them through.

In total, 41 players fell at the first hurdle, leaving 69 players still standing. Deadline for Round 2 is Friday 24th October at noon. A full update can be viewed here.
